Step 2: Point GraphLoom at the new metadata store. The visualizer no longer crawls repositories directly; it reads edges from the Corvid index, so the old crawler flags can be deleted from your local setup. New team members should copy the sample profile before editing anything. After the index connection succeeds, update your instance to use the following configuration values.

deployment values, yadug-bawif:
[framir]
team = pelox
access_code = ac_a38ab2
owner = tamion.julael
host = framir.tolvaqlabs.test
port = 11211
peer = tammir.zemvargrid.local
salt = 2215ef03
pin = 1541

## Break-Glass: FeedCheck Validator

Hey reviewer — quick context. FeedCheck is Larkmoor Audio's podcast feed validator. If its admin plane locks everyone out (expired certs, usually), break-glass gets you a read-only shell to rotate credentials. All use is logged and triggers a page to the duty lead. The emergency shell accepts the recovery passphrase shown directly below.

vault phrase of kawef-yahop = wenir-jorox-druys-belion-kelion-lamvan-frawyn-norael-julox-raleth-rusax-oliys-holael

## PrintWhisk Spooler — Environments

PrintWhisk runs in three environments: dev, staging, and prod. Each environment maintains its own spool queue on the Quillhaven cluster; jobs never cross environments. Staging mirrors prod retry behavior, so a stuck queue there usually predicts a prod incident. If you are paged for spool saturation, check the active config first before draining. The current production configuration values are listed below.

config for bahof-tagep:
kelael:
  pin: 3701
  tenant: fraius
  seal: seal_566287a7
  metrics_host: metrics.kelael.ferradyn.local
  standby_team: sormir
  escalation: juldor-oliir
  nonce: 530523

Quick notes for the security review. Ledgerlens uses one service account per environment, no exceptions — we learned that the hard way after the Great Staging Mixup. Each account can only read the audit-event stream from our internal event-spine service; no writes, no deletes, nothing spicy. Rotation happens monthly via the Clockvault job, and old keys are revoked within an hour. For convenience while you poke around staging, here's what you need. The current staging key for the event-spine service is below.

API key for tagef-fafop: vxb2-ta